How much do computer science new grad j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for computer science new grad in Monument, CO is $107,537.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$91,300.00 and $132,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What do computer science new grads do?

As a Computer Science New Grad, you will often start with foundational tasks such as fixing bugs, developing small features, writing tests, and assisting in code reviews. These assignments help you become familiar with the company's codebase, workflows, and development tools while providing opportunities to learn from experienced colleagues. You may also be involved in team meetings, participating in project planning sessions, and collaborating with other developers, product managers, or QA specialists. Over time, as you gain experience and confidence, you'll likely take on larger, more complex projects with greater responsibility. This structured approach allows new grads to build essential skills and smoothly transition into more advanced roles.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a computer science new grad?

To thrive as a Computer Science New Grad, you need a solid understanding of programming fundamentals, algorithms, and data structures, typically backed by a relevant degree such as a Bachelor’s in Computer Science or related field. Familiarity with industry-standard programming languages (such as Python, Java, or C++), version control systems like Git, and experience with development environments or cloud platforms is high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, eagerness to learn new technologies, and effective communication skills help new grads excel in collaborative and fast-paced team settings. These competencies are crucial for adapting to real-world projects, contributing effectively to technical teams, and building a successful early career trajectory.

What is a computer science new grad?

A Computer Science New Grad job is an entry-level position designed for recent graduates with a degree in computer science or a related field. These roles typically focus on software development, data analysis, cybersecurity, or IT support, depending on the company. Employers seek candidates with strong programming skills, problem-solving abilities, and knowledge of industry-standard tools and technologies. New grads often receive mentorship and training to help them transition into professional environments.
